SOUTH RAKAIA SCHOOL COMMITTEE
» An adjourned meeting of the above wu bold on Monday :— Present Messrs Hardy (Chairman,) Shannon, O, Dlxon, Llddy, Hirvey and Oxley. The master reported the average attendance for the past month, 161/4; pait week 1712; highest attendance 191; No. on roll 207 5 admitted daring the month, 11. lie also reported that the aohool buildings required renovating Intlde and out. It was resolved to have the mutter of providing orloketfug materials for the obildren m the handa of Messrs Dlxon and Oxley. The Chairman reported that the sam of s ! xtaon shillings had been recovered from t.be boys who broke the aohool windows. It was resolved not to depart from the decision of the late Committee, and that the school grounds cou'd not be ased by the Rskala cricket olnb. A letter was reoalved from the Board, to the eflfaot that Mfsa Bllton ooald not be appointed bb infant mistress. Sixteen applications wore received for the position of Infant mistress. As Miss Belton was not an sppHoaut this time, it was unanimously rosolved on the motion of Mr D;xon seoonded by Mr Shannon to reoonxneod Miss Seymour. Attention was called to an unpleasant ppidemlo running throngh the aohool, and the Oahlrman snd Mr Oxley were pppqlnted to make fall ecqalry Into the matter, and take aotlon. Aoooants were passed for payment and the Committee adjourned.
